When scholars explore new ideas, it seems instinctive to share their thinking. Last year computer science professors Joseph Halpern and Bart Selman became co-principal investigators for a nationwide project to ensure that robots and artificial intelligences (AIs) will act in ways beneficial to humans. "We thought we should get undergrads involved in thinking about these ideas," Selman said. Thus was born a new course, CS 4732, Ethical and Social Issues in AI, about how robots and artificial intelligences may change our world, and what we ought to be doing about it. "These undergrads may be directly involved in developing the software behind these systems," Selman added, noting that many may go on to jobs with Google, Tesla and other major players.

Depressed or Suicidal? AI Algorithm Detects What's Hidden Beneath the Smile - ExtremeTech

#artificialintelligence

You may think you're good at reading other people's faces and moods. But when it comes to telling the difference between a person who is suicidal and one who is merely depressed, the signs are much more subtle. To tease out the differences, the researchers looked at a handful of facial gestures displayed by three groups of people – those with suicidal ideation, depressed patients, and a medical control group. During interviews with these groups, they recorded gestures that included smiling, frowning, eye brow raising, and head motioning. The data was then fed into a machine-learning algorithm that looked for correlations between different gestures, alone or in combination, and patient groups.

Gridsum and Tencent Cloud Debut Intelligent Voice Recognition System to Support Legal Services in China - NASDAQ.com

#artificialintelligence

BEIJING, June 16, 2017 (GLOBE NEWSWIRE) -- Gridsum Holding Inc. ("Gridsum" or the "Company") (NASDAQ:GSUM), a leading provider of cloud-based big-data analytics, machine learning and Artificial Intelligence solutions in China, today announced the debut of the Intelligent Voice Recognition System jointly developed with Tencent Cloud to help improve the efficiency of the legal system across China. The advanced AI-enabled Intelligent Voice Recognition System converts voice into text in real time during court proceedings. Gridsum adapted the Tencent speech recognition technology to create a high-accuracy and high-reliability speech-to-text and text-to-speech application for the highly specialized legal space. This technology was surrounded and integrated with/into a comprehensive Software as a Service (SaaS) suite of solutions for the juridical system including judges, courts, law firms and corporates. Gridsum is working in collaboration with the Supreme Court Press to disseminate these solutions throughout the Chinese juridical system.

Boost legal infra development for AI adoption in India: Study

#artificialintelligence

India should encourage research and innovation in establishing a legal infrastructure on the application of Artificial Intelligence (AI), says an Assocham-PwC study report titled'Leveraging artificial intelligence and robotics for sustainable growth.' The report highlighted the areas of application for AI techniques in large-scale public endeavours such as Make in India, Skill India and other crop insurance schemes, tax fraud schemes, detecting subsidy leakage and defence and security strategy. "The Make in India initiative focussing on twin goals of strengthening the country's in-house innovation and production capabilities with added creation of employment opportunities may not end up creating as many jobs as it is poised to at this point in time," the report said. Also, information technology (IT), manufacturing, agriculture and forestry are certain sectors that are expected to experience shrinkage of employment demand as robotic systems and machine learning algorithms take up several tasks, it noted.


Neural networks take on quantum entanglement

#artificialintelligence

Machine learning, the field that's driving a revolution in artificial intelligence, has cemented its role in modern technology. Its tools and techniques have led to rapid improvements in everything from self-driving cars and speech recognition to the digital mastery of an ancient board game. Now, physicists are beginning to use machine learning tools to tackle a different kind of problem, one at the heart of quantum physics. In a paper published recently in Physical Review X, researchers from JQI and the Condensed Matter Theory Center (CMTC) at the University of Maryland showed that certain neural networks--abstract webs that pass information from node to node like neurons in the brain--can succinctly describe wide swathes of quantum systems . Dongling Deng, a JQI Postdoctoral Fellow who is a member of CMTC and the paper's first author, says that researchers who use computers to study quantum systems might benefit from the simple descriptions that neural networks provide.
